Description

Lignoceroyl ethanolamide is a member of the family of fatty N-acyl ethanolamines collectively called endocannabinoids. Whereas lignoceric acid has been detected at relatively high levels in rat cerebrospinal fluid, the specific role and relative importance of its ethanolamine metabolite have not been determined.

Molecular Weight

411.70

Formula

C26H53NO2

CAS No.
SMILES

O=C(NCCO)CCCCCCCCCCCCCCCCCCCCCCC
